Margaret Margareth Percy was born in 1448 in Leconfield, East Riding, Yorkshire, England, the child of Sir Lord Henry III Algernon de Percy, and Eleanor de Poynings (Percy),. Margaret Margareth Percy passed away in 1487 in Gawthorpe, Yorkshire, England.
